Properties of Quadrilaterals

Any four sided plane figure is called a quadrilateral.

Examples of quadrilaterals are:

A. Parallelogram

A parallelogram is a quadrilateral whose pairs are equal and parallel.

Plane shapes - Properties of Quadrilaterals- Parallelogram

Properties of Parallelogram

  1. Its opposite sides are parallel and equal
  2. Its opposite angles are equal
  3. Its diagonals bisect each other
  4. Each diagonal bisects the parallelogram into two congruent triangles
  5. The (4) angles together add up to 3600
